You are asked to identify compound x, which was extracted from a plant seized by customs inspectors. you run a number of tests and collect the following data. compound x is a white, crystalline solid. an aqueous solution of x turns litmus red and conducts electricity poorly, even when x is present at appreciable concentrations. when you add sodium hydroxide to the solution a reaction takes place. a solution of the products of the reaction conducts electricity well. an elemental analysis of x shows that the mass percentage composition of the compound is 26.68% c and 2.239% h, with the remainder being oxygen. a mass spectrum of x yields a molar mass of 90.0 g mol"1. (a) write the empirical formula of x. (b) write the molecular formula of x (c) write the balanced chemical equation and the net ionic equation for the reaction of x with sodium hydroxide. (assume that x has two acidic hydrogen atoms.)
